HB 3668 Oklahoma House · 2024 Regular Session

Medicaid fraud; statute of limitations; criminal procedure; adult sexual abuse; Oklahoma Racketeer-Influenced and Corrupt Organizations Act; definition; Medicaid fraud; penalty; dollar threshold; felony and misdemeanor; fine and imprisonment; effective date.

This Oklahoma law updates the time limits for prosecuting various crimes and expands the definition of racketeering to include elder abuse and Medicaid fraud. It specifically extends the window for filing Medicaid fraud charges to five years after discovery, aligning it with other financial crimes like embezzlement. Additionally, the bill lowers the dollar amount required for Medicaid fraud to be charged as a felony and adds specific fines and prison terms. The legislation also clarifies that sexual abuse of vulnerable adults counts as racketeering activity under state law.
